问题标签 [ultraedit]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
regex - 使用 ultraedit 查找和替换 Perl 正则表达式将冒号插入 4 位时间字符串
我通过几个文件有多个 24 小时时间字符串。例如,1234,我希望将其替换为 12:34。
找到它们很容易,只需 \d\d\d\d,我理解并且它有效。但是,我需要什么替换字符串。换句话说,比如说 xx:xx,我用什么来代替每个 x。
我尝试了很多东西都无济于事。我显然不明白我是如何让它记住它找到的数字并在替换字符串中调用它们的。
regex - 如何使用 UltraEdit 中的正则表达式查找具有一位或多位数字的数字?
我在 UltraEdit 中使用正则表达式搜索字符串amzn-src-id="[0-9]"
,但结果是找到的只是数字1
,9
即只有一位数字。
例如:amzn-src-id="1"
, amzn-src-id="2"
, amzn-src-id="3"
, ...,amzn-src-id="9"
如何解决?
我需要找到amzn-src-id="4798"
不只是一位数字的标识符号之类的字符串。
regex - 使用正则表达式从 xml 中删除行
我正在处理一个巨大的 xml 文件并且不想使用 XML 软件,因为我从 PubMed 网站导出的 xml 文件的结构不正确,并且会不时更改,所以我想在 notepad++ 或 ultraedit 中删除一些 xml 节点用正则表达式。例如,如何删除这一整行?
ultraedit - UltraEdit / Unix 正则表达式。我想用名称替换所有行 + 空格 + 带有名称的数字 + # + 数字 SANTIAGO 80,00
UltraEdit / Unix 正则表达式。我想用名称替换所有行 + 空格 + 用名称 + # + 数字的数字
示例:SANTIAGO 80,00 将替换为 SANTIAGO#80,00 并且所有行都将像这样进行
我可以在 Unix 表达式中找到我想要搜索的内容:[^t^b][0-9]
regex - 使用正则表达式选择基于肯定标准的行,但排除基于否定的某些行
如果在某个地方有答案,我深表歉意,但如果有的话,我的搜索技能会让我失望。
我正在使用 UltraEdit,我需要从一些 JSON 模式中删除一些行,以便更轻松地比较它们。
所以给出以下内容:
使用这个正则表达式:
选择这些行:
我需要做的是跳过 $ref 行。
我试图通过选择标准以各种方式使用 (?!json) 进行消极的环顾工作,但惨遭失败。
这样做的目的是删除选定的行。
谢谢你的帮助。
更新:为了澄清,我想删除与我的 Regex 找到的条件匹配的行,但我不想删除 $ref 行。所以我希望找到一种相对简单的方法来使用 UltraEdit 中的直接 perl 正则表达式来做到这一点。
我已经使用 Python 脚本创建了一个解决方法,因此我可以完成我的工作,但是找出是否有办法做到这一点仍然很有趣。:)
regex - UltraEdit/Notepad - XML 删除具有空属性的节点
我目前正在使用的软件遇到问题,该软件从外部软件接收我们确实需要处理的几个 Xml,现在我们的问题是这些 Xml 文件包含很多完全无用的节点和也因此使文件(xmls)非常重,结果程序运行速度非常慢以处理每个xmls,这应该在未来改变,我想证明通过删除这些节点我们会改进我们的处理时间很多,现在我想作为第一步手动执行此操作,使用示例 xml 并应用正则表达式语法来删除所有 value 属性为空的节点,这是我现在一直使用的语法记事本中的替换功能我可以删除这些行,然后删除空行:
例子
在我的例子中,节点可以有不同的命名并且可以有不同的属性,但是我应该关心的是那些在 value 属性中包含某些东西的节点,因此在这种情况下我应该删除第二行
这看起来工作正常,但是对于非常大的文件(10 mb),替换记事本++ 功能似乎有问题,并且它停止正常工作,破坏了很多标签......
我尝试使用另一个名为“Ultraedit”的软件,但我猜它的语法不同,因为我可以使用正则表达式但需要选择其中一个选项:Perl、Unix、Ultraedit;只使用“Perl”我可以做这个替换,但也有,对于大文件,这不起作用,我得到以下错误:
匹配表达式的复杂性已超出可用资源..
谁能帮我解决这个问题?不幸的是,我什至对正则表达式都不是很好,我不确定上面的代码是好是坏..
html - 如何在 UltraEdit 中将 CSS 链接到 HTML?
我刚刚开始在 Mac 上使用 UltraEdit 进行 HTML 和 CSS 编码。(我是 HTML 新手,我在 Windows 上的 Notepad++ 中只做了一点点。)
问题是我无法将我的 CSS 文件附加到我的 HTML 文件中,所以 HTML 确实可以工作(它非常基本),但 CSS 没有应用于它。
HTML 和 CSS 文件在同一个文件夹中,所以它应该像在 Notepad++ 中一样工作。
这是我的 HTML 文件:
CSS 文件(dgt 2.css):
所以,正如你所见,这一切都非常简单,但我不知道为什么标题不是绿色的。
我已经对此进行了研究,但是所有编码人员都做同样的事情,并且在其他应用程序中也可以使用。
regex - 如果后续行短于 X 个字符,则从文本文件中删除 CR
我有一个 6 GB 大的大型文本/csv 文件。创建时发生错误,并且尚未从字段中删除一些换行符(CRLF),因此某些行被破坏
这里是一个简化版本:
例如
所以第 3 行中的字段 3 有一个 CR,因此该行被断开
我不想重新创建需要太长时间的 CSV 文件,但必须有一种方法可以在正则表达式和工具的帮助下解决这个问题。
很容易识别断线。它们的长度少于 50 个字符。所有好的行都超过 50 个字符
所以我需要一个步骤: * 识别短行 * 删除该行前面的 CRLF * 对整个文件执行此操作
我可以在 UltraEdit 中创建一个宏并搜索 Perl Regex
并更换前面的CRLF。这行得通,但需要的时间太长。UltraEdit 中的宏很方便,但速度很慢。
还有其他方法吗?我可以使用带有一些工具的正则表达式来搜索/替换吗?
谢谢,沃尔夫冈
csv - 替换大txt文件中的字符
我有一系列.txt
文件需要上传到 Google Cloud,以便在 BigQuery 中从中创建一些表。这些文件是分隔符为“;”的表格。
出于某种原因,当文件处于此形状时,BigQuery 似乎在识别列(自动或不自动)方面存在问题,即使指定“;”也是如此。作为分隔符。
我生成了一个示例表,并查找并替换了“;” 带有一些“,”并将文件保存为.csv
. 现在 BigQuery 在创建 apt 表时没有问题。
问题:我应该查找并替换所有表格中的所有分隔符吗?还是我错过了什么?
如果是,我如何在 OS 10 上实现 sep 提示命令?(文件很大,我在使用 UltraEdit 时也遇到了及时替换字符的问题)
最好的!
regex - UltraEdit(或 MacOS 正则表达式):删除 xml 中的多行
我有一个未格式化的 xml 文件,我想在其中删除包含某些值的特定名称的标签。
例子:
... 代表随机字符和随机多行
在上面的示例中,我想删除正文中包含“SearchTerm”的所有 XmlElement2 元素。换句话说,选择位于中间的多行之间<XmlElement2
和</XmlElement2>
跨多行的所有文本SearchTerm
并替换为“”。
我在 MacOS 上使用 UltraEdit,并且可以灵活地使用哪些工具。
非常感谢您的帮助!